YEAR END RAFFLE AND MEMBERSHIP DRIVE

To raise money for the club and future events, we are raffling off
a complete Eclipse 12g aquarium system (generously donated by Aquarium Gallery)
This would make a great display or self contained Quarantine/Hospital tank.

Raffle Tickets are $5 each  or 3 for $10 and available to anyone.

As a New/Renew club member bonus, if you sign up as a New paid member or Renew your existing membership for $25 for the year between Nov 15th and December 7th, you will get a FREE ticket and automatically be entered for the prize drawing.

The prize drawing will be held at our December meeting at Aquarium Gallery December 7th.
You do NOT have to be present to win.

For club members doing early renewals:  The renewal will extend after the remainder of your current yearly membership so you won't lose any time!


Tickets and/or memberships may be purchased at the December meeting up until the actual drawing on Dec 7th, or on-line by sending via PayPal to graveyardworm@comcast.net.  You can also send a personal message to any of the club staff to make other payment arrangements for tickets or memberships.
